15th World Scout Moot 2017

Theme: Change – Inspired by Iceland

Dates: 25 July – 2 August 2017

Place: 10 Expedition centers / Base camp at

Ulfljotsvatn Scout Centre

People: 5.000 participants and 1.000 International

Service Team members (IST)

Who can participate• Participants, born on or between the dates of 2nd

August 1991 and 25th July 1999

• IST´s, born on or before 1st August 1991

• All participants and IST´s are part of a national

contingent – one contingent per country

• Max 500 participants and 100 IST pr. country.

• No contingent can have more IST than participants.

Exhibition Centers• 10 Expedition Centres, in 10 different places • Each site offers a program that meets the World

Moot standards of an educational program.• Each Centre is graded in three main program

areas:• Motion and adventure (A 1-3)• Community involvement (C 1-3)• Nature and environment (N 1-3)

• Participants choose a Centre site based on their program interest

Participants organization

• Ten person patrols, based on a common journey interest, max 2 people from each country• Four partrols form a tribe• Advisors are assigned to each tribe- as a rule, one

Icelandic, one non-Icelandic• The patrol is responsible for accommodation and

program participation (tents etc.). • The tribe is responsible for daily living, food etc.

Moot fee• 250 USD category A country • 500 USD category B country• 750 USD category C country• 1000 USD category D country

Late registration fee, 5% addition

Contingent Leaders‘ Meeting

• Will be held in Iceland 22nd – 24th of July 2016 during the national jamboree in Iceland• Meeting will be at the camp site, Ulfljotsvatn

Scout Centre. • You are welcome to join the jamboree as well,

held from 17th – 24th of July – www.jamboree.is • Head of contingent, jambassasdors, key figuers in

your association may join. • More information will be sent out in September

2015.

Registration• 30 November 2014, NSO´s submit a statement of

intend to participate in the Moot and give the hoped for number of participants and IST• 1 January 2016, NSO´s submit the name of the

head of contingent• 1 October 2016, formal registration starts• 31 December 2016, formal registration closes
